A day in the life of a Lettings Branch Manager:
  • Leading daily meetings with the Lettings team
  • Coaching the team to achieve KPI’s
  • Monitoring and assessing individual team member performance (Including but not limited to conducting one-to-one meetings)
  • Encouraging your team's development and progression
  • Strong focus on generating new and repeat business
  • Developing and maintaining strong relationships with Landlords and Tenants
  • Liaising with Tenants and arranging property viewings in line with their needs
  • Negotiating offers and agreeing new tenancies
  • Ensuring the business is risk-averse and following the highest compliance standards for all regulatory bodies.
Essential Skills of a Lettings Branch Manager:
  • Full UK Driving Licence for a manual vehicle
  • Minimum of 2 years’ experience within residential lettings at a Senior Negotiator position or higher
  • Works well with others to create a team spirit and an enjoyable working environment.
  • Demonstrates an ability to communicate effectively with and create trusting relationships with customers, suppliers, communities and each other
  • The ability to create and action business plans relevant to your branch
  • The ability to monitor and assess performance of local competitors
  • A strong understanding of current legislation related to Residential Lettings
  • Ability to manage time sensitive and high volume workloads
  • A reputation for delivering outstanding customer service
  • Ability to work under own initiative
  • Good telephone manner
  • Strong IT skills (Basic Microsoft Packages)
  • Attention to detail
